如何在不牺牲缩进的情况下在Python中换行? 例如: def fun(): print '{0} Here is a really long sentence with {1}'.format(3, 5) 假设这超过了79个字符的推荐限制。 我读到的方法是:如何缩进: def fun(): print '{0} Here is a really long \ sentence with {1}'.format(3, 5) 然而,用这种方法,续行的缩进符合fun()的缩进。 这看起来有点丑。 如果有人要通过我的代码,那么由于这个print语句的原因,会有不均匀的缩进。 如何在不牺牲代码可读性的情况下有效缩进这样的行?
我有以下string: ",'first string','more','even more'" 我想将其转换成一个数组,但显然这是无效的,由于第一个逗号。 我怎样才能从我的string中删除第一个逗号,并使其成为一个有效的数组? 我想结束这样的事情: myArray = ['first string','more','even more'] 谢谢。
我想从我的strings.xml文件中的另一个string引用一个string,如下所示(特别注意“message_text”string内容的结尾): <?xml version="1.0" encoding="utf-8"?> <resources> <string name="button_text">Add item</string> <string name="message_text">You don't have any items yet! Add one by pressing the \'@string/button_text\' button.</string> </resources> 我已经尝试了上面的语法,但是文本以纯文本的forms打印出“@ string / button_text”。 不是我想要的。 我想要消息文本打印“您还没有任何项目!按'添加项目'button添加一个。 有没有什么已知的方法来实现我想要的? 理由: 我的应用程序有一个项目列表,但是当这个列表是空的时候,我会显示一个“@android:id / empty”的TextView。 该TextView中的文本是通知用户如何添加一个新的项目。 我想让我的布局更改傻瓜(是的,我是个傻瓜:-)
$string = "1,2,3" $ids = explode(',', $string); var_dump($ids); 回报 array(3) { [0]=> string(1) "1" [1]=> string(1) "2" [2]=> string(1) "3" } 我需要的值是inttypes而不是stringtypes。 有没有更好的方式做这个比foreach循环数组,并将每个string转换为int?
在.Net中,为什么String.Empty只读而不是一个常量? 我只是想知道是否有人知道这个决定背后的推理。
我想在django模板标签中连接string {% extend shop/shop_name/base.html %} 这里shop_name是我的variables,我想连接这个path的其余部分。 假设我有shop_name=example.com 我想要扩展shop/example.com/base.html
我想在Swift中将Int转换为带前导零的String 。 例如考虑这个代码: for myInt in 1…3 { print("\(myInt)") } 目前的结果是: 1 2 3 但我希望它是: 01 02 03 在Swift标准库中有没有干净的方法?
我怎么能分割一个string,如下面的多行? var text:String = "This is some text over multiple lines" 请注意,从2017年起,您只需使用三重引号即可。
将TimeSpan对象格式化为具有自定义格式的string的build议方法是什么?
我发现了这个怪事: for (long l = 4946144450195624l; l > 0; l >>= 5) System.out.print((char) (((l & 31 | 64) % 95) + 32)); 输出: hello world 这个怎么用?